Tasks

 1. Contributors - create map products (any extent, any scale)
       a) eg1 carbon maps for each province using specifications
          eg2 regional carbon maps
          eg3 national maps for forests
          eg4 national maps for agricultural areas
          eg5 national map for the north
       b) masks for eg bedrock, wetlands, urban, water
       c) Point data
       d) suggest AB BM CB BH JD XG GL JB SS
       
 2. Aggregators - assemble contributions into final map
       a) prioritize / merge / overlay / mosaic / blend
       b) fill gaps
       c) suggest CB SS BL JB XG BM
       
 3. Data repository
       a) contributors store their own datasets to achieve 1a.
       b) aggregators store outputs from 1a, 1b and final products
       c) wiki serves as data repository
           (i)   contributors post original links to all input data
                   - cded, canvec, srtm, imagery, lcc 2000
           (ii)  contributors post metadata for links 
                   - extent, scale, license (could be 'don't know') 
           (iii) contributors post methods used to process data from 3c(1)
                   - eg SAGA - GIS for slope, aspect, wetness, mrvbf
                   - eg NDVI from landsat cloud free date range
                   - etc
       d) proposed structure for wiki based data repository:

Timeline

  Dec 2016
      Contributors provide info on what they will be producing
      Wiki implemented as a data "repository"
  Jan 2017
      Contributors report on progress, identify problems, needs
      Aggregators initialize the datasets, feed some data, evaluate gaps
  Feb 2017
      Contributors provide 1st drafts of contributions to aggregators
      Aggregators provide 1st draft of product (eg slc, forest C inventory, polar)
  March 2017
      Iterations of products form contributors and aggregators
